Did you know that bread is best stored at room temperature?

Did you know that the next storage method for consideration after room temperature is the deep freezer? Yes, frozen bread restircts the growth of mold which lengthens the ‘shelf life’ – up to 3 months. 

Did you know that storing bread in a refrigerator encourages bread to go stale quickly.

One day in the refrigerator is equivalent to three days at room temperature.
